Hip pain (peds)

Clinical Presentation

  • It can be difficult to differentiate hip from knee pain in children

Differential Diagnosis

Pediatric limp

Hip Related

  • Acute rheumatic fever
  • Developmental dysplasia of hip
  • Femur fracture
  • Juvenile idiopathic arthritis
  • Legg-Calve-Perthes disease
  • Septic arthritis of the hip (peds)
    • Lyme disease arthritis
  • Slipped capital femoral epiphysis
  • Transient (toxic) synovitis
  • Osteosarcoma

Other Causes of Limping

  • Developmental dysplasia
  • Fracture
    • Toddler's fracture
    • Tillaux fracture, adolescent
  • Neoplasm:
    • Leukemia
    • Ewings
    • Osteogenic sarcoma
    • Metastatic neuroblastoma
  • Osteomyelitis
  • Myositis
  • Other:
    • Appendicitis
    • Meningitis
    • Epidural abscess (spinal)

Work-Up

  1. X-ray hip, knee
  2. Consider CBC, ESR
  3. Consider hip US (vs CT)
